WebIn 2024, 857 people were killed and 44,240 people were injured in work zone crashes. Work zone crashes are defined as taking place within the boundaries of a work zone or on an approach to or exit from a work zone due to activities, behaviors, or controls related to traffic moving through the boundaries of a work zone. WebDec 17, 2024 · Construction Safety. The construction industry again had the highest number of fatalities of all industries in 2024 with 1,061 worker deaths. This is a 5.3% increase over the 1,008 fatal injuries in 2024. It’s the highest total since 2007 when the industry recorded 1,204 fatal work injuries.
